General-duty citation text
Section 5(a)(1) of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970: The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to the possibility of being crushed as a result of a rollover of the Case Loader/Backhoe. This machine was not provided with a rollover protective structure (ROPS) to protect employees should a rollover occur. Among other methods, one feasible and acceptable abatement method to correct this hazard is to install a proper rollover protective structure on this machine: Abatement Note: 29 CFR 1926.1001 details the minimum performance criteria for rollover protective structures for this type of machine. Also, all machinery equipped with ROPS shall be provided with seat belts.
